摘要:本文对TP钱包“糖果口袋”进行全方位综合分析,覆盖高效能技术应用、小蚁(NEO)生态联动、先进科技趋势、交易与支付场景、全球化科技革命背景以及Golang在架构中的实际应用与落地路径。文章还给出详细的分析流程、风险权衡与实施建议,引用权威文献以提升结论的可靠性与可验证性。
什么是“糖果口袋”及其价值链:在中文区块链语境中,“糖果”通常指空投、激励或微额代币分发,TP钱包的“糖果口袋”可被理解为一个聚合、筛选、管理并为用户展示可领取/已持有激励资产的功能模块。它在用户增长、社区活动与代币分发中承担黏性与入口价值。为保证准确性,本文以TP钱包公开资料与行业通行定义为基础进行分析[1][2]。
高效能技术应用:实现一个面向百万级用户同时在线、支持多链事件监听与批量签名的糖果口袋,需要从系统架构到底层实现都优先考虑吞吐与稳定性。一方面,Golang凭借goroutine和轻量级并发控制、成熟的网络库与良好的工程化工具链,通常是实现高并发后端的优选(参考Go官方文档与go-ethereum实践)[4][5]。另一方面,可借助WebAssembly对第三方合约执行进行沙箱化,使用eBPF进行内核级观测与流量策略,结合RocksDB/LevelDB做轻量索引以实现低延迟链上事件检索[6][7]。在密码学运算上,采用经过优化的C/ASM库或硬件加速(AES-NI、Intel SGX/HSM)可显著缩短签名与验证的延迟。
小蚁(NEO)与生态接入:小蚁(AntShares,现称NEO)拥有独特的资产模型与代币标准(如NEP系列),若糖果口袋要兼容NEO生态,必须实现NEO RPC、合约事件解析与NEP代币标准的映射逻辑,并确保对GAS/NEO的特殊账务处理与分发规则的合规支持[3]。从推理角度,跨链支持越多,系统需要的适配层就越复杂,进而对高性能消息队列、幂等性处理与一致性模型提出更高要求。
先进科技趋势:当前影响钱包与支付未来的关键技术包括零知识证明(zk-SNARK/zk-STARK)用于隐私保护与轻量状态验证;Layer-2与Rollup用于吞吐扩展(兼顾安全性);多方计算(MPC)与TEE用于非托管多签与密钥分片;以及跨链互操作协议(如IBC/跨链桥)以打通资产流动。合理引入这些技术,可以在保证原子性与安全的前提下,降低链上复杂度并提升用户体验[10][6][8]。
交易与支付场景:糖果口袋从原本的“展示+索取”功能,具备向“支付入口”演化的潜力。通过接入稳定币、法币通道(fiat on/off-ramp)与即时结算层(例如Lightning、支付通道或Rollup),钱包可以把小额奖励自然转化为可消费的支付余额。在全球化视角下,CBDC的推进与监管合规(KYC/AML)也将对钱包功能产生直接影响,TP钱包应在用户隐私与合规之间建立可审计但可控的设计[2][8]。
Golang在实现中的角色与实战建议:建议将核心后端拆分为微服务:API网关(gRPC/REST)、链上索引器(订阅节点、存储事件)、认领引擎(排队/防刷)、签名服务(支持MPC/HSM)、跨链适配层以及监控/告警模块。关键实现建议包括:使用protobuf进行二进制传输以降低延迟;采用Kafka或NATS做异步任务总线;通过go pprof、flame graphs进行CPU/内存剖面;通过Prometheus+Grafana+Jaeger实现指标与调用链追踪;并在Kubernetes上以垂直/水平弹性伸缩策略支撑峰值流量[4][5]。这些选择有助于在保证稳定性的同时维持低延迟的用户体验。
详细描述分析流程(方法论):
步骤一:需求与风险界定——明确糖果口袋的业务边界、支持链种类、合规需求与TAM(目标用户规模)。
步骤二:数据与事件采集——建立链上索引器、合约ABI/事件解析器与代币白名单体系,使用去中心化来源与链上证明提升数据可信度。

步骤三:原型与性能基准——用Golang搭建原型服务,设计模拟并发场景(使用k6/wrk),记录TPS、P99延迟与GC行为。
步骤四:安全评估和威胁建模——针对热路径(签名、私钥处理、跨链桥)做模糊测试与第三方审计(参考OWASP移动安全指南与智能合约审计工具)。
步骤五:合规与隐私设计——结合KYC策略、日志可审计性与最小化数据收集原则实现合规。
步骤六:灰度发布与监控——实施Canary发布、SLO/SLA设定、实时告警与自动弹性伸缩。
权衡与建议:系统设计需在可用性、安全性与去中心化之间做权衡。推荐路径为:前端保持非托管(私钥不出端设备),后端作为可信索引与聚合层;核心签名链路采用MPC或HSM以降低单点被盗风险;对跨链功能采取“适配器+审计层”策略以便快速下线存在安全隐患的桥;优先采用Golang构建高并发服务,同时为后续引入zk与Rollup预留接口与数据证明格式。
结论与百度SEO优化建议:TP钱包的糖果口袋既是用户增长口,也是技术挑战聚合点。采用Golang与现代微服务架构、结合zk、MPC与跨链适配,可以在保安全的前提下实现高并发与全球化扩展。为满足百度搜索优化,建议页面标题、H1使用“TP钱包 糖果口袋”,在首段与Meta描述中插入核心关键词,保持内容原创性与结构化(FAQ、常见问题、结构化数据),并保证移动端加载速度与页面时效性。
互动问题:
1) 你更倾向哪种技术栈实现糖果口袋?
A. Golang + Kafka + HSM B. Node.js + MongoDB + 外部托管签名 C. Golang + MPC + Rollup
2) 对于跨链糖果,最担心的风险是什么?
A. 桥漏洞 B. 法规风险 C. 用户体验/费用
3) 如果让你投票,是否支持TP钱包优先接入小蚁(NEO)生态?
A. 支持 B. 观望 C. 不支持

4) 你希望获取哪类后续内容?
A. 实战代码与架构图 B. 安全与审计流程 C. 法规与合规指南
参考文献:
[1] TP钱包(TokenPocket)官方网站 https://www.tokenpocket.pro/
[2] Satoshi Nakamoto, Bitcoin: A Peer-to-Peer Electronic Cash System https://bitcoin.org/bitcoin.pdf
[3] NEO(小蚁)官方与开发文档 https://neo.org/ 或 https://docs.neo.org/
[4] Go 官方文档与性能指南 https://go.dev/
[5] go-ethereum(geth)实践 https://geth.ethereum.org/
[6] WebAssembly 官方 https://webassembly.org/
[7] eBPF 项目 https://ebpf.io/
[8] Bank for International Settlements(BIS)关于跨境支付与CBDC的研究 https://www.bis.org/
[9] OWASP Mobile Top 10 https://owasp.org/www-project-mobile-top-ten/
[10] Vitalik Buterin, Rollup-centric Ethereum https://vitalik.ca/general/2021/01/05/rollup.html
评论
CryptoFan88
这篇分析很系统,特别赞同Golang做后端的建议。期待看到实战架构图。
张小蚁
关于小蚁(NEO)的兼容细节讲得很到位,建议补充NEP-17的示例。
技术宅
建议增加具体的性能基准和测试方法(比如k6/pprof的配置)。
LunaMoon
互动问题设置得很好,我会投票选择Golang + MPC + Rollup 方案。